Viral Photo Reveals Neglect Along Grand Floridian Shoreline
The unchecked image has raised questions about whether cost cuts or pandemic-related staffing strains are undermining Disney’s famed maintenance standards.
Overview
- A guest photo shared July 31 shows overgrown weeds and litter lining the Grand Floridian Resort’s shoreline and quickly gained widespread attention on X.
- Longstanding routine of daily shoreline patrols and sand raking appears to have lapsed, contrasting sharply with Disney’s historic upkeep.
- Disney enthusiasts voiced disappointment and demanded the company address the visible neglect at one of its premier resorts.
- The company has not issued any statement regarding the allegations of environmental neglect.
- Observers and fans suggest recent cost-management measures or lingering pandemic staffing challenges could be affecting resort maintenance.
